Hi....I just recently joined. Not sure the etiquette for posting as this is my first post. I am recently starting collecting the State Quarters (clad and silver proofs) for my young sons. What is the going price for 99 silver proof set in your opinion? I recently got one for $150. Thought that was fair but not sure. Beautiful set, saving them as a family heiroom.
